Product Overview

The 061B110766 (061B110766) is a professional-grade industrial pressure switch engineered for precise monitoring and control within low-pressure and vacuum systems. Featuring a high-sensitivity bellows sensing element, this switch is designed to provide reliable switching logic for applications ranging from -0.20 to 1.00 bar. Its robust construction makes it an essential safety and regulation component in industrial boiler systems, HVAC climate control, and fluid management infrastructures. The 061B110766 is encased in an IP65-rated housing, ensuring total protection against dust ingress and low-pressure water jets, maintaining operational integrity even in challenging mechanical room environments where moisture and debris are prevalent.

Technical Configuration

The 061B110766 utilizes a modular mechanical design to ensure compatibility with standard industrial piping and electrical layouts:

  • Bellows Sensing Technology: The internal stainless steel or copper alloy bellows provide superior repeatability and a low deadband, ideal for detecting minute pressure fluctuations in vacuum or low-pressure gas lines.

  • Specialized Setting Range: Specifically calibrated for a range of -0.20 to 1.00 bar, allowing for accurate control in sub-atmospheric and near-atmospheric processes.

  • Industrial Connectivity: Equipped with a standard G-type threaded pressure connection and a Pg 11 electrical cable gland for secure, leak-proof integration.

  • High Maximum Working Pressure: While the switching range is low, the sensing element is designed to withstand a maximum working pressure (Pe) of up to 15.0 bar, preventing damage during system pressure tests or unexpected surges.

Technical FAQs

Can the 061B110766 be used for vacuum monitoring?

Yes. With a setting range starting at -0.20 bar, this switch is capable of monitoring partial vacuum conditions, making it suitable for vacuum pump control or air intake monitoring in combustion systems.

Is this switch suitable for outdoor installation?

The IP65 enclosure rating provides protection against rain and dust; however, for outdoor installations in extreme climates, a protective weather shield is recommended to prevent ice buildup on the bellows housing or UV degradation of the electrical seals.

What is the significance of the 15.0 bar Pe rating?

The Pe rating indicates the maximum static pressure the bellows can withstand without permanent deformation. Even though the switch operates at 1 bar, it can safely remain in a system that occasionally reaches 15.0 bar during maintenance or process spikes.


Engineering & Installation Guide

  • Mounting Orientation: To prevent the accumulation of condensate or debris within the bellows, it is recommended to mount the switch with the pressure connection facing downwards. If mounted horizontally, ensure the piping is sloped away from the device.

  • Electrical Sealing: To maintain the IP65 rating, the Pg 11 cable gland must be tightened according to the cable diameter used. Ensure the cable entry points downwards to create a "drip loop," preventing water from traveling along the cable into the terminal block.

  • Pulsation Damping: In systems where rapid pressure pulses or vibrations are present (such as near reciprocating pumps), install a capillary tube or a pressure snubber at the G-connection to protect the bellows sensing element from fatigue and premature failure.
